netWRK
Späť na Blog

Multi-agentová orchestrácia: Keď AI agenti spolupracujú

Prečo jeden AI agent nestačí? Ako funguje multi-agentový systém, kde špecializovaní agenti spolupracujú na komplexných úlohách. Case study Surgence Labs + technická architektúra.

2. apríla 20265 min readnetWRK Team
Zdieľať
Multi-agentová orchestrácia: Keď AI agenti spolupracujú

Úvod

Jeden AI agent je mocný nástroj. Ale čo keď potrebujete riešiť komplexnejší problém? Napríklad: Automatizovať celý marketing research workflow – od zberu dát na sociálnych sieťach, cez analýzu konkurencie, až po generovanie reportov a ich distribúciu.

Tu prichádza multi-agentová orchestrácia – systém, kde viacero špecializovaných AI agentov spolupracuje na jednej úlohe. Každý agent má svoju expertízu a výsledky si odovzdávajú navzájom.

V tomto článku ukážeme, ako to funguje v praxi na príklade Surgence Labs – austrálskeho klienta netWRK.

Prečo viac agentov > jeden super-agent?

Analógia: Predstavte si futbalový tím. Môžete mať jedného hráča, ktorý vie všetko (brankár, obranca, útočník). Alebo môžete mať 11 špecializovaných hráčov, každý expert vo svojej pozícii.

Multi-agentový systém funguje podobne:

Výhody:

  • Špecializácia: Každý agent robí jednu vec výborne (zber dát / analýza / reporting)
  • Paralelizmus: Agenti pracujú súčasne → rýchlejšie výsledky
  • Škálovateľnosť: Pridať nového agenta je jednoduchšie než rozširovať monolitický systém
  • Resilience: Ak jeden agent zlyhá, ostatní fungujú ďalej

Nevýhody:

  • Komplexnejšia architektúra: Potrebujete orchestráciu (kto čo robí a kedy)
  • Komunikácia medzi agentmi: Musia si odovzdávať dáta správne
  • Vyššia počiatočná investícia: Vývoj je zložitejší než jeden agent

---

Case Study: Surgence Labs Marketing Research System

Profil:

Surgence Labs (Austrália) – tech startup poskytujúci marketing insights pre blockchain projekty.

Problém:

Potrebovali nepretržite monitorovať:

  • X/Twitter: Trendy, mentions, influenceri
  • Telegram: Diskusie v komunitných kanáloch
  • PR médiá: CoinDesk, CoinTelegraph, Decrypt
  • Konkurencia: Čo robia podobné projekty

Manuálny proces by vyžadoval 2-3 full-time analytikov.

Riešenie od netWRK:

Multi-agentový systém s 5 špecializovanými agentmi:

Agent #1: Twitter Scout

Úloha: Monitorovanie X/Twitter

Nástroje: Twitter API, sentiment analysis

Output: JSON s trending topics, influencer mentions, sentiment scores

Agent #2: Telegram Listener

Úloha: Monitoring Telegram kanálov

Nástroje: Telegram API, keyword extraction

Output: Najdôležitejšie diskusie, community sentiment

Agent #3: PR Media Crawler

Úloha: Scraping PR médií (CoinDesk, CoinTelegraph...)

Nástroje: Web scraping, RSS feeds

Output: Nové články relevantné pre klienta

Agent #4: Competitor Analyst

Úloha: Analýza konkurencie

Nástroje: Web monitoring, social media APIs

Output: Competitive insights (čo konkurencia spustila, ako komunikuje)

Agent #5: Report Generator

Úloha: Zhrnutie všetkých dát do prehľadného reportu

Input: Dáta od agentov #1-4

Output: Google Doc + Telegram notifikácia s kľúčovými insights

---

Architektúra: Ako agenti spolupracujú

```

┌─────────────┐ ┌─────────────┐ ┌─────────────┐ ┌─────────────┐

│ Twitter │ │ Telegram │ │ PR Media │ │ Competitor │

│ Scout │ │ Listener │ │ Crawler │ │ Analyst │

└──────┬──────┘ └──────┬──────┘ └──────┬──────┘ └──────┬──────┘

│ │ │ │

└──────────────────┴──────────────────┴──────────────────┘

┌──────────────────┐

│ Orchestrator │

│ (Coordinator) │

└─────────┬────────┘

┌──────────────────┐

│ Report Generator │

└─────────┬────────┘

┌─────────────┴─────────────┐

▼ ▼

┌──────────┐ ┌──────────┐

│ Google │ │ Telegram │

│ Docs │ │ Alert │

└──────────┘ └──────────┘

```

Workflow:

1. Orchestrator spustí agentov #1-4 paralelne (každé ráno o 8:00)

2. Agenti zbierajú dáta zo svojich zdrojov (15-30 minút)

3. Každý agent uloží výsledky do spoločnej databázy

4. Orchestrator spustí Report Generator

5. Report Generator spojí dáta, vygeneruje markdown report, uploadne do Google Docs

6. Telegram alert pošle notifikáciu: "Nový marketing report je pripravený: [link]"

Čas celého procesu: 30-45 minút (paralelne)

Výsledok: Daily marketing report pripravený automaticky

---

Výsledky pre Surgence Labs

Pred netWRK:

  • 2.5 analytikov full-time (~€8 000/mesiac)
  • Týždenné reporty (manuálne zostavovanie)
  • Delay: 3-5 dní medzi eventom a reportom

Po netWRK:

  • Multi-agentový systém (~€2 000/mesiac)
  • Daily reporty automaticky
  • Real-time: Event na Twitteri → v reporte do 24 hodín

ROI:

  • Úspora: €6 000/mesiac = €72 000/rok
  • Break-even: 6 týždňov
  • Bonus: Rýchlejšie reakcie na trendy = lepší marketing timing

---

GymBeam: Multi-agentová éra

GymBeam už má 5 AI agentov vo firme, každý s vlastným Slack kontom:

| Agent | Rola | Úloha |

|-------|------|-------|

| Mya AI | Product Content Specialist | Tvorba produktového obsahu |

| Eric AI | Junior Purchasing Specialist | Objednávky dodávateľom |

| Bob AI | Junior Data Analyst | Analýzy v Tableau, Google Sheets |

| Voldy AI | Junior QA Engineer | Testovanie funkcií |

| Crytex AI | AI Security Engineer | Bezpečnosť ostatných agentov |

Spolupráca:

  • Eric AI objedná materiál → Crytex AI skontroluje, či bola transakcia bezpečná
  • Mya AI vytvorí produktový opis → Voldy AI otestuje, či sa správne zobrazuje na webe
  • Bob AI vygeneruje sales report → Eric AI ho použije na predikciu objednávok

---

Kde sa multi-agentové systémy využívajú

1. Marketing & Research

  • Agent #1: Social media monitoring
  • Agent #2: Competitor analysis
  • Agent #3: SEO research
  • Agent #4: Report generation

2. E-commerce

  • Agent #1: Zákaznícka podpora (chat)
  • Agent #2: Spracovanie objednávok
  • Agent #3: Reklamácie
  • Agent #4: Inventory management

3. Finance & Accounting

  • Agent #1: Invoice processing
  • Agent #2: Expense categorization
  • Agent #3: Fraud detection
  • Agent #4: Reporting

4. HR & Recruiting

  • Agent #1: Resume screening
  • Agent #2: Interview scheduling
  • Agent #3: Candidate communication
  • Agent #4: Onboarding automation

---

Ako postaviť multi-agentový systém

Krok 1: Rozdeľte problém na sub-úlohy

Čo všetko treba urobiť? Napr. marketing research:

  • Zber dát (Twitter, Telegram, PR)
  • Analýza sentimentu
  • Competitive intelligence
  • Report generation

Krok 2: Definujte agentov

Každý agent = jedna sub-úloha. Špecifikujte:

  • Input: Odkiaľ berie dáta?
  • Output: Čo produkuje?
  • Nástroje: Aké API/nástroje používa?

Krok 3: Navrhnite komunikáciu

Ako si agenti odovzdávajú dáta?

  • Spoločná databáza
  • Message queue (napr. RabbitMQ)
  • API endpointy

Krok 4: Orchestrácia

Kto rozhoduje, ktorý agent kedy beží?

  • Cron (časované úlohy)
  • Event-driven (trigger po dokončení predchádzajúceho agenta)

Krok 5: Monitoring & Alerting

Čo ak jeden agent zlyhá? Potrebujete:

  • Health checks (je agent živý?)
  • Error alerts (Telegram/Slack notifikácia)
  • Retry logic (automatický re-run pri zlyhaní)

---

Prečo spolupracovať s netWRK

Multi-agentové systémy sú zložité. Potrebujete partnera, ktorý:

  • Navrhne architektúru (ktorých agentov potrebujete)
  • Postaví agentov a orchestráciu
  • Zabezpečí monitoring a údržbu

netWRK špecializuje na multi-agentové systémy. Naše projekty:

  • Surgence Labs: 5 agentov pre marketing research
  • GymBeam: 5 agentov naprieč oddeleniami
  • B2B služby: 3 agenti pre lead processing

Objednajte si konzultáciu a zistíte, či multi-agentový systém dáva zmysel pre vás.

---

Časté otázky

Kedy potrebujem multi-agentový systém?

Keď jeden agent nestačí – komplexný workflow s viacerými sub-úlohami.

Je to drahšie než jeden agent?

Vývoj áno (~2-3× vyšší), ale long-term benefit je vyšší (škálovateľnosť, resilience).

Ako dlho trvá vývoj?

Jednoduchý systém (2-3 agenti): 1-2 mesiace. Komplexný (5+ agentov): 2-4 mesiace.

Čo ak jeden agent zlyhá?

Ostatní agenti fungujú ďalej. Orchestrator detekuje zlyhanie a alertuje.

---

Kontakt

Chcete multi-agentový systém vo vašej firme?

👉 Objednajte si bezplatnú konzultáciu na netWRK

👉 Pozrite si case studies

👉 Vyskúšajte AI DEMO